Fortnite’s Tilted Towers is back

Titled Towers Fortnite’s most famous and recognizable location, has returned to the battle royale. The game’s most popular landmark rejoined the map with the latest patch, available Tuesday, which also revealed that the city has been hidden in the thawing ice on the new Chapter 3 island.

Tilted Towers was a city of destructible buildings and skyscrapers. Fortnite’s first battle royale island map. Tilted towers saw its Chapter 1 time from October 2017 through October 2019. It was rebuilt once or twice and then destroyed in an emotional memorial by players. But it didn’t make the cut for Chapter 2’s map.

Other areas are also available Fortnite have proven to be popular, and Chapter 2 had its own fair share of famous destinations, nothing ever reached the cultural consciousness — or in-game popularity of Tilted Towers.

Tilted Towers was able to achieve its current status thanks to memes on Reddit and TikTok. Fortnite’s most important location; it was also one of the game’s most fun places to fight. These massive structures allowed for a variety of exterior and interior battles, which could take place anywhere from the street to several stories above ground. This was an amazing experience. There were often 10 to 12 players there for every match. You knew that you would be in for an entertaining fight.

Tilted Towers’ return isn’t the only thing that this latest Fortnite The patch was added to the game. Fortnite patch v19.10 introduced players to Klombos. They are giant creatures that roam the island, and can be used to transport you quickly. They are usually harmless, unless they’re provoked. Klomberries are another favorite fruit of the Klombos. The new fruit is able to calm an angry Klombo, or give it to one of its docile relatives in exchange for random goodies. Also, the patch unvaults the previous season’s Grenade Launcher.
